Unexpected Increase in Mustard Area

PANAMA - Jul 3/16 - SNS -- North American mustard seed production could jump 64% this year if seeded area estimates for Canada and the United States remain unchanged.

Statistics Canada surprised markets by pegging this year's seeded area at 525,000 acres, up from 345,000 last year; while the USDA said area in the United States jumped from 44,000 to 60,500 acres.

Planting seed was expected to be a limiting factor in Canada. But, the expansion reported by Statistics Canada forced market participants to muse that when prices are high farmers have an uncommon ability to find common seed.
